What You Can Expect from the Tour

Palermo: Wine Tasting with Sicilian Tapas - What You Can Expect from the Tour

Starting Point and Setting

The tour begins just in front of the Oratorio delle Dame, situated on one of Palermo’s oldest streets, leading to the bustling Ballarò market. This location sets the tone — authentic, lively, and full of local charm. As you gather with your small group, you’ll notice the welcoming vibe that makes everyone feel at home.

The Wineries and Wines

You’ll taste four wines, carefully selected from some of Sicily’s most sought-after and non-commercial producers. This isn’t mass-produced stuff; it’s the real deal, crafted by passionate winemakers committed to quality. Reviewers often comment on the wines being “delicious” and “superb,” with full pours that let you really savor each flavor.

The fact that these are boutique wineries means you might find wines with unique characteristics, reflecting Sicily’s diverse terroirs. Many reviews highlight the hosts’ ability to explain the wines’ origins and what makes each one special, enhancing your appreciation.

The Food Pairings

Alongside the wines, traditional Sicilian tapas are served, complementing the flavors and adding a culinary layer to the experience. The snacks are described as “great,” “authentic,” and “delightful,” with some reviews noting they’re a perfect match for the wines. While some might find the snacks a bit light, most agree they’re enough to enhance the tasting without overshadowing the wine.

Atmosphere and Views

The small balcony overlooking a 1700s church is a standout feature — an unexpected yet charming spot to sip wine and take in the historic surroundings. The ambiance is described as “warm,” “inviting,” and “stylish,” making it feel like a secret haven in the busy streets of Palermo.

Duration and Group Size

The tour lasts approximately two hours, making it an ideal way to relax after exploring Palermo’s sights or before heading out for dinner. Small group sizes are typical, which means personalized attention and the chance to ask plenty of questions.
